Skip to content
Snippets Groups Projects
Commit 627b8d1c authored by Levente Polyak's avatar Levente Polyak :rocket:
Browse files

relax version pinning

also fix intention
parent 9e66a56d
No related branches found
No related tags found
No related merge requests found
......@@ -3,7 +3,7 @@
_name=schema
pkgname="python-$_name"
pkgver=0.7.1
pkgrel=3
pkgrel=4
pkgdesc='Python module to validate and convert data structures.'
arch=(any)
url="https://github.com/keleshev/$_name"
......@@ -14,18 +14,26 @@ license=(MIT)
source=(https://files.pythonhosted.org/packages/source/${_name::1}/$_name/$_name-$pkgver.tar.gz)
sha256sums=('c9dc8f4624e287c7d1435f8fd758f6a0aabbb7eff442db9192cd46f0e2b6d959')
prepare() {
cd "$srcdir/$_name-$pkgver"
# accept arbitrary versions
sed 's|==|>=|g' -i requirements.txt
}
build() {
cd "$srcdir/$_name-$pkgver"
python setup.py build
cd "$srcdir/$_name-$pkgver"
python setup.py build
}
check() {
cd "$srcdir/$_name-$pkgver"
python setup.py test
cd "$srcdir/$_name-$pkgver"
python setup.py test
}
package() {
cd "$srcdir/$_name-$pkgver"
python setup.py install --root="$pkgdir/" --optimize=1 --skip-build
install -D -m644 LICENSE-MIT "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E"
cd "$srcdir/$_name-$pkgver"
python setup.py install --root="$pkgdir/" --optimize=1 --skip-build
install -D -m644 LICENSE-MIT "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E"
}
# vim: ts=2 sw=2 et:
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ment